Transcript of Interview with Pat Altavilla, January 12, 2022

Nicole Petallides It’s time for our spotlight now. We are spotlighting Suneva Medical.  The regenerative aesthetics company announced its SPAC merger agreement this morning.  Joining us with all the details is the company’s CEO, Pat Altavilla.  Thank you so much for being with us. Very excited that you could be on with us today.  I know all about your products and an exciting time for rejuvenation.  Tell me a little bit about why now and what the goals are here.
Pat Altavilla Why now? Because it’s a – we are truly at an inflection point.  The company over the last 18 months has really built out a comprehensive portfolio of regenerative aesthetics products and we are very excited about that and we are truly at that inflection point; that’s why now.
Nicole Petallides Absolutely and as I looked through your products the Bellafill seems to be getting all the hype as this filler can last for years, right?
Pat Altavilla Up to 5 years  - we have a 5 year indication from the FDA.  Very exciting.
Nicole Petallides Yeah, I’m sure it is. So, as you move forward with this merger, what are the expectations right now.  You have VHAQ which is Vivian Health and then eventually you will be Renew – that will be the new ticker symbol upon closing.  What’s the timing right now, the expectations?
Pat Altavilla The expectation is that the merger will close sometime in the first half of this year.
Nicole Petallides And when you look at what’s going on in the world of rejuvenation, the part that is so exciting about Suneva in particular is that it’s immediate results.  It’s noninvasive.  Right?  Tell me a little bit about the company and your enthusiasm about it.
Pat Altavilla Well Suneva is a great company that has been building its portfolio over the last 18 months. We started the Pandemic with a simple product in our portfolio and we have been very purposeful about the products that we’ve brought on.  We wanted these products to really meet the patient’s needs, really throughout each decade of life, and – from 20’s to 90’s – and each of our products offers something a little bit different.  We fundamentally built the portfolio on 4 basic pillars: structure, volume, lift and rejuvenation.  And our product portfolio really answers every one of those needs, So we really have a fulsome portfolio to offer to our practices.
